Nearby Similar Businesses
0.00 miles
Lambeth North Underground Station
Lambeth North Underground Station, 110 Westminster Bridge Road, Lambeth, London, SE1 7XG
0.34 miles
Waterloo Underground Station
Brad Street, Lambeth, London, SE1 7ND
0.34 miles
Waterloo Underground Station
York Road, Lambeth, London, SE1 7ND
All London Underground stations operate a strict No Smoking policy.
We have multiple businesses linked to this address, if you'd like to see what else is listed here please click:
Open address data
User Reviews
There are no user reviews
Have your say
Add a review or useful tip for this business